Jessica Biel regrets taking racy photos at 17

Jessica Biel, who played the role of Mary in the popular television series “7th Heaven,” caused quite a stir when she posed semi-nude for Gear magazine.

The pictures got her in trouble with her TV boss, Aaron Spelling. However, Biel is now back from a year studying at Tufts University and is beginning her final full season on the WB drama, which premiered on September 24.

She is also starring in the new baseball comedy “Summer Catch.”

In an interview with EW.com, she spoke openly about her college plans and the infamous cheesecake photos.

In “Summer Catch,” Biel plays a privileged girl who is torn between pleasing her parents and herself.

This was a conflict that Biel could relate to.

She said, “What I like about her is that even though she doesn’t want to disappoint her parents and she sees her father’s trying to do what’s best for her, she’s a young woman and she needs to make decisions for herself.”

Biel’s pictures in Gear caused her family a great deal of distress.

She stated that she was not happy with those pictures and was shocked that the pictures that ran in the magazine were different from the ones she saw.

She said that her family was heartbroken about the pictures that ran.

However, she has made peace with the situation and said, “It’s over now, and I’m okay with it, and my family knows that that’s never ever going to happen again.”

Biel had to mend fences with everyone at the WB and the series itself. However, it was a difficult process, and the photo shoot was a bad decision on her part.

She said, “I got myself involved with people who weren’t thinking about me and were instead thinking about what kind of a story they could get out of it.”

She also said that the experience taught her a lot, and she doesn’t look back on it negatively anymore.

There was speculation that Biel was trying to get fired by appearing too sexy to play Mary.

However, Biel said that she just wanted to cut her hair and dye it a different color.

She said, “I was 17 years old and totally rebellious, so I was just like, ‘What do you mean I can’t dye my hair? You can’t tell me what to do!'”

She now views this as a poignant lesson and wants people to see her as a normal human being who makes mistakes.

Biel took a year off to attend Tufts University, but she decided to return to “7th Heaven” for one last year.

She said, “The thinking was that I wanted to be full time for one last year, make it the best year ever, and just enjoy it before I go back to school.”

Biel also confirmed that she would be back to make appearances in seasons seven and eight.

Despite her desire to finish school and pursue other acting opportunities, Biel said that she would consider returning to “7th Heaven” if the show continued past season eight.

She said, “If the show goes past season eight and they ask me if would want to be a part of it, I would love to.”

Biel hopes that people will see her as a normal person who has made mistakes.

She said, “I want people to see me as a really normal human being who screws up. Just like everybody else.”
